Understanding the Core Functionality
At its heart, a platform such as this functions as a decentralized system built upon blockchain technology. This underlying technology introduces transparency and security, ensuring that all transactions and interactions are verifiable and tamper-proof. This is a significant departure from traditional online gaming platforms, where trust is often placed in a central authority. The usage of blockchain allows for provably fair gaming, meaning players can independently verify the randomness and fairness of each game or event. This feature is critical for building trust and fostering a secure gaming environment. Moreover, the decentralized nature of the system reduces the risk of censorship or manipulation, ensuring a level playing field for all participants. The emphasis on open-source code further contributes to transparency, allowing anyone to review and audit the system’s underlying logic.
The Role of Cryptocurrencies
Cryptocurrencies typically play a central role in these platforms, serving as the primary medium for transactions and rewards. This integration offers several advantages, including faster transaction speeds, lower fees compared to traditional banking systems, and increased privacy. Users can deposit and withdraw funds directly using various cryptocurrencies, eliminating the need for intermediaries. The use of smart contracts automates the distribution of rewards and ensures that payouts are executed automatically when predetermined conditions are met. This automation reduces the potential for human error or manipulation and streamlines the reward process. The integration of cryptocurrencies also opens access to a global audience, enabling players from around the world to participate without facing geographical restrictions.
| Cryptocurrency | Transaction Speed | Typical Fees |
|---|---|---|
| Bitcoin (BTC) | Moderate (10-60 minutes) | Relatively High |
| Ethereum (ETH) | Fast (15-30 seconds) | Moderate |
| Litecoin (LTC) | Very Fast (2-5 minutes) | Low |
| Dogecoin (DOGE) | Fast (1-5 minutes) | Very Low |
Understanding the nuances of each cryptocurrency and its associated characteristics is important for maximizing efficiency and minimizing costs when using this type of platform. Careful consideration should be given to transaction speeds and fees when choosing a cryptocurrency for deposits and withdrawals.

Navigating the Risks and Challenges
While platforms like these offer numerous benefits, it is essential to be aware of the potential risks and challenges associated with their use. The volatile nature of cryptocurrencies is a significant concern, as the value of tokens can fluctuate dramatically in a short period. This volatility can impact the value of rewards earned on the platform and may require users to carefully manage their risk exposure. Security is another critical consideration. While blockchain technology offers inherent security features, users must still take precautions to protect their accounts and private keys from hacking and phishing attacks. Using strong passwords, enabling two-factor authentication, and being vigilant against suspicious activity are essential security measures.
